3x + 1/5y = 7

To solve for a variable, you have to isolate the variable that you want to solve. In this case, we want to solve for "x," so we must isolate "x."

So, subtract 1/5y from both sides.

3x = -1/5y + 7

Then, divide both sides by 3.

3x ÷ 3 = (-1/5y + 7) ÷ 3

Simplify.

x = -1/15y + 7/3
